What often happens in Internet auctions of this type is that there is a flurry of bids in the final stages of the game (i.e., as closing time approaches). The Ebay system, and the Internet in general, is not fast enough to post all these bids. Thus, with about 45 sec left, incoming bids are no longer posted.
Explain what type of auction this "window of no information" simulates, and explain why this may also work to yield high bids for the sellers. What attribute of the artwork are you assuming the product has in this case?
